Ajax tries to attract Gerónimo Rulli

Gerónimo Rulli is at the top of Ajax’s wish list, transfer expert Fabrizio Romano reported on Friday. The Dutch club wants to attract a goalkeeper in the winter break anyway and the Villarreal goalkeeper is the most serious option for the time being. Thirty-year-old Rulli, who has been stuck in Spain for another year and a half, won the world title with Argentina, even though he was not first choice under national coach Lionel Scaloni.

First contact made with Gerónimo Rulli

According to Romano, Ajax has already made the first contacts with the management of Rulli, one of the most important forces in the selection of Villarreal. The experienced goalkeeper has been playing for the current number nine in LaLiga since mid-2020. In his first season, Rulli immediately conquered the Europa League. In the final won against Manchester United, he played a heroic role in the penalty shootout by turning the effort of colleague David de Gea. As a result, Villarreal eventually won in a blood-curdling series 11-10.

Aging goalkeepers in Amsterdam

Ajax manager Alfred Schreuder usually opts for Remko Pasveer this season, with Maarten Stekelenburg and Jay Gorter as back-up. It has been known for some time that Ajax is looking for a new goalkeeper. Het Parool recently reported that SC Heerenveen requires at least ten million euros for World Cup participant Andries Noppert. BILD revealed that Alexander Nübel is also on the list. David Raya

Brentford goalkeeper David Raya seems to be another option for Ajax, the team of transfer market expert Gianluca Di Marzio reports. Just like Rulli, Raya was in Qatar but never played a minute during the 2022 World Cup tournament. Raya is a starter for Brentford, so it will be the question if he’s willing to leave the Premier League for the Dutch Eredivisie.
